Why EE12P Fits the 1-Ton Market Momentum
As cities prioritize pedestrian-friendly sidewalk repairs and homeowners invest in outdoor living spaces, the need for a rubber track mini excavator for residential jobs has never been higher. The EE12P 1-ton mini excavator addresses this with a 934mm body width—narrow enough to fit through standard garden gates—and 180mm rubber tracks that protect lawns and paved surfaces from damage. Powered by a 7kw KEPU192 engine, it delivers 8–10 hours of runtime on a 6.6L fuel tank, making it a cost-effective choice for all-day DIY patio installs or small-contractor irrigation line digging. Its 360° body swing and 850mm swing radius also let operators rotate fully within a 1.2m footprint, eliminating the need to reposition the machine when loading soil into a wheelbarrow—a time-saver that has boosted its popularity among residential users by 32%.
For multi-task mini excavator for micro-construction needs, the EE12P’s interchangeable attachments (enlarged bucket, front shovel, thumb grip) let users switch from grading flower beds to clearing debris with one machine, reducing the need to rent specialized tools. This versatility has made it a staple for small landscaping businesses, which report 25% lower project costs when using the EE12P instead of manual labor or larger equipment.
